Hello again from Lanzarote

Hello again from Lanzarote! I’ve had lots of adventures since I last wrote. The biggest one was going for a ride on a camel – she was huge! I sat in a basket hooked over her hump which wobbled around a lot as she walked along. She wasn’t very friendly and kept turning round to spit at me! Most of the camels had someone sitting on each side of the basket to balance it, but because I’m so small and light I was allowed one all to myself. All the camels walked along in a procession, though I decided from the spitting that she’d rather have stayed lying down. Not that I could blame her in that heat!


The camels walked a long way up the side of a mountain, which turned out to be a volcano! I’ve seen lots of pictures of volcanoes but couldn’t believe I was actually on one. Sarah and I got off our camels and poked a big stick with twigs on the end down into the crater, and it was so hot down there that they caught fire!
